As a Climber Foreman (Crew Leader), you will take on a hands-on leadership role, guiding a team of skilled arborists in delivering high-quality tree care services. This position is ideal for individuals who enjoy working outdoors, leading by example, and are passionate about arboriculture. Responsibilities

  • Lead and supervise a tree care crew to ensure productivity, efficiency, and excellent customer service.
  • Plan and organize daily job tasks, allocate resources, and delegate responsibilities to crew members.
  • Operate and manage specialized equipment, including chainsaws, chippers, aerial lifts (bucket trucks), and cranes as needed.
  • Regularly climb and perform tree work to support crew production and job completion.
  • Conduct on-site safety meetings and enforce OSHA regulations and company safety policies.
  • Maintain job site cleanliness and ensure proper maintenance and security of equipment and vehicles.
  • Communicate effectively with clients and crew members, addressing concerns and ensuring satisfaction.
  • Complete job paperwork, reports, and site assessments accurately and in a timely manner.
Qualifications

  • Minimum 2 years of experience in a leadership role within the tree care industry.
  • Hands-on experience in tree climbing, rigging, pruning, removal, and general tree operations.
  • Strong knowledge of tree biology, proper pruning techniques, equipment use, and safety standards.
  • Valid driver's license required.
  • Willingness to obtain a CDL Class B (with airbrake endorsement or higher).
  • ISA Certifications (Certified Arborist, Tree Worker Climber Specialist, etc.) or similar credentials are a plus.
  • Ability to operate and/or direct aerial lifts, cranes, and other heavy machinery safely and effectively.
  • Excellent leadership, time management, and communication skills.
  • Strong focus on safety, quality, and customer service.
  • Reliable, self-motivated, and able to work in various weather conditions.
